Benefits of Staying in a Getaway Home in Blairsville, GA

0
7

In 2026, the travel landscape in North Georgia has shifted. While traditional hotels offer convenience, more travelers are choosing the immersive experience of a private residence. Blairsville, with its high-elevation ridges and the pristine waters of Lake Nottely, is the ideal backdrop for this "slow travel" movement. Choosing a managed property or a private retreat offers a level of reconnection that a standard room simply cannot provide.

 

From the financial advantages for groups to the mental health benefits of mountain seclusion, here is why a Getaway Home in Blairsville, GA is the superior choice for your next Appalachian escape.


1. Authentic Mountain Living vs. Commercial Stays

Staying in a hotel often feels the same regardless of the zip code. In contrast, Holiday Homes in Blairsville, GA allow you to live like a local.

 

  • The Neighborhood Experience: Instead of a lobby, you wake up to the sounds of Coosa Creek or the sight of deer crossing a private ridgeline.

  • Custom Architecture: Many Blairsville rentals feature authentic log construction, soaring stone fireplaces, and floor-to-ceiling windows designed specifically to frame the 2026 views of Brasstown Bald.

2. Superior Value for Families and Groups

When you analyze the "cost per person," a private home often outperforms a block of hotel rooms.

 

  • The Kitchen Advantage: With grocery prices being a major factor in 2026 travel budgets, having a full kitchen is a game-changer. Preparing just one meal a day at home can save a family of four hundreds of dollars over a week-long stay.

     

  • Communal Spaces: In a getaway home, the "hangout" doesn't end when you leave the restaurant. You have private living rooms, fire pits, and game rooms where your group can bond without the noise and intrusion of other hotel guests.

     


3. Privacy and Personal Wellness

Blairsville is known as the "quieter side of the mountains," making it a premier destination for those seeking a "digital detox."

  • No Shared Walls: Forget the sound of elevators or hallway foot traffic. A getaway home offers a literal sanctuary. In 2026, many homes are marketed as "quiet retreats," featuring dedicated meditation nooks or yoga decks overlooking the Chattahoochee National Forest.

  • Private Amenities: Why share a crowded hotel pool when you can have a private hot tub on a screened-in porch? Vacation Rentals in Blairsville, GA often include hyper-local perks like private creek access, outdoor pizza ovens, or telescopes for stargazing in Blairsville's famously dark skies.

4. Seamless Work-from-Mountain Integration

The "slomad" (slow nomad) trend is in full swing in 2026. Travelers are staying longer and blending work with leisure.

 

  • The Remote Office: Most premier Vacation Homes for Rent in Blairsville, GA are now equipped with high-speed fiber internet and dedicated desk spaces.

  • Work-Life Balance: Imagine finishing a video call at 5:00 PM and being on a kayak in Lake Nottely or hiking the Appalachian Trail by 5:15 PM. This immediate access to nature is a benefit no urban hotel can replicate.


Why 2026 is the Year for Blairsville

As over-tourism impacts more famous mountain towns, Blairsville remains a place where you can find a secluded trail or a quiet corner of the lake even in peak July. Choosing a getaway home gives you the "keys to the kingdom," providing a home base that is as much a part of the vacation as the destination itself.

 

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Are vacation homes in Blairsville pet-friendly? A: A significant majority (over 60%) of Blairsville rentals are pet-friendly. In 2026, many even offer "pet welcome kits" and fenced-in yard areas, which is a major benefit over restrictive hotel pet policies.

Q: How do I handle check-in without a front desk? A: Most homes now use 2026 smart-lock technology. You'll receive a unique digital code on the day of your arrival, allowing you to head straight to your mountain home and start your vacation immediately.

Q: Is it safe to stay in a remote mountain home? A: Yes. Blairsville is one of the safest communities in Georgia. Furthermore, managed vacation homes are equipped with 2026 safety tech, including exterior security cameras, ring doorbells, and 24/7 emergency maintenance contacts.
